Kinds of Keys for Ford Focus

Before diving into the replacement process, it's crucial to acknowledge the various types of keys you may experience with a Ford Focus. Knowing what type you have will alleviate the key replacement procedure.

Type of KeyDescriptionReplacement Cost EstimateStandard KeyStandard metal key without any electronic parts₤ 10 - ₤ 30Transponder KeyKey with an ingrained chip for included security₤ 50 - ₤ 150Smart Key/ Key FobKeyless entry remote which consists of push-to-start functionality₤ 150 - ₤ 300

The cost of key replacement can vary based upon car dealership rates, locksmith professional charges, and your geographical location.

Steps for Key Replacement

When it comes to replacing your Ford Focus key, you typically have 2 primary options: going through a dealership or utilizing a regional locksmith professional. Below are the actions involved for both approaches:

Option 1: Dealership Method

  1. Gather Necessary Information: You will require evidence of ownership for your automobile, such as the automobile title, registration, or even your insurance documents. Also, have your vehicle Identification Number (VIN) all set.

  2. Contact a Ford Dealership: Call or visit your local Ford dealer's service department. Ask about the possibility of key replacement and validate whether they can develop a new key from your VIN.

  3. Set up an Appointment: Depending on your car dealership, you might require to arrange an appointment for key cutting and programming.

  4. Get Key Cut and Programmed: Once at the car dealership, service technicians will cut your new key and program it to your automobile. This procedure may spend some time, so be gotten ready for a wait.

  5. Check the Key: Before leaving, guarantee that the replacement key works correctly by checking all performances (locking/unlocking, beginning the engine).

Option 2: Locksmith Method

  1. Verify Locksmith Credentials: Choose a reputable locksmith who focuses on vehicle keys. Confirm that they have the required devices to develop a Ford Focus key, particularly if it is a transponder or smart key.

  2. Prepare Documentation: Just like with the dealer, have your evidence of ownership and VIN available.

  3. Ask for a Quote: Get a quote on the cost before proceeding. Lots of locksmith professionals will be considerably more affordable than a car dealership, particularly for basic and transponder keys.

  4. Check out the Locksmith: Schedule a time to bring your car in, or see if they offer mobile services.

  5. Key Cutting and Programming: Once there, the locksmith professional will take measurements or codes and produce your key. They will likewise configure it if necessary.

  6. Check the Key: Ensure to carry out a thorough test to verify the key functions as required.

Cost Breakdown for Key Replacement

It's important to have a budget plan for key replacement. Here's a breakdown of prospective costs related to each key type:

Key TypeCost EstimateProgramming FeeOverall Estimated CostStandard Key₤ 10 - ₤ 30₤ 0 - ₤ 10₤ 10 - ₤ 40Transponder Key₤ 50 - ₤ 150₤ 30 - ₤ 75₤ 80 - ₤ 225Smart Key/Fob₤ 150 - ₤ 300₤ 30 - ₤ 75₤ 180 - ₤ 375

These estimates can change based upon area and service company.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What should I do if my Ford Focus key is lost?

  • If your key is lost, consider your choices for replacement (dealer vs. locksmith professional) and collect your car documentation before continuing to change the key.

2. Can I reprogram my own Ford Focus key?

  • Some Ford Focus keys can be reprogrammed by following specific steps described in the lorry's manual; however, numerous keys require customized devices at a dealership or locksmith.

3. How long does it take to replace a Ford Focus key?

  • Replacing a key can differ in time, generally taking around 30 minutes to an hour at a dealership and possibly quicker with a mobile locksmith.

4. Is it less expensive to change a key through a locksmith or car dealership?

  • Typically, locksmiths offer more budget friendly choices for key replacement, specifically for basic and transponder keys.

5. What if my key will not turn the ignition?

  • If your key won't turn, the concern might be with the key itself, the ignition cylinder, or a dead battery. Seek advice from a locksmith professional for assessment.
